Chopin Etudes
Yunchan Lim 
CD CLA CHO 
 
Last year, the then 18-year-old South Korean pianist Yunchan Lim "stunned the music world" (The New York Times) by becoming the youngest winner of the Van Cliburn International Piano Competition in Texas. Yunchan's final performance of Rachmaninoff's Piano Concerto No. 3 not only moved the conductor on stage to tears, but critics also praised the astonishing interpretation, saying he was an "instant sensation" and "a star is born" (The New York Times). Now Yunchan Lim presents his first studio album on Decca Classics: the Chopin Etudes op. 10 and op. 25.

Jubilee
Old Crow Medicine Show 
CD C&W OLD 

As multiple Grammy-winners, Old Crow Medicine Show celebrates their 25th anniversary. Their new album, Jubilee, finds the band producing alongside Matt Ross-Spang (Jason Isbell, St. Paul & The Broken Bones). The record features a return cameo from OCMS co-founder Willie Watson as well as appearances from legend Mavis Staples and rising star Sierra Ferrell. The result encompasses everything from jug-band tunes to Irish folk songs to exultant gospel jams.

Blue Heron Suite
Sarah Jarosz
CD FOL JAR 
 
Sarah Jarosz's Blue Heron Suite is a song cycle she composed after being the recipient of the Fresh Grass Composition Commission. Recorded in 2018 at Reservoir Studios in New York City, Jarosz is joined on the album by Jeff Picker on bass and Jefferson Hamer on guitar and harmony vocals.

Beethoven Blues
Jon Batiste 
CD JAZ BAT 
 
5x Grammy® and Oscar® winner Jon Batiste returns with a pure piano album, Beethoven Blues (Batiste Piano Series, Vol. 1). Reimagining the transcendent works of Ludwig van Beethoven alongside original compositions inspired by Batiste's youth competing in local piano competitions and gigging in the heart of New Orleans, the album extends timeless classics across the genre spectrum.

2014 Forest Hills Drive
J. Cole 
CD POP COL 

J. Cole's third studio album, 2014 Forest Hills Drive, topped the U.S. album chart when it was released in 2014 and has been certified 3x platinum. It features the singles "Apparently," "Wet Dreamz," and "No Role Modelz."
Songs Of A Lost World
The Cure 
CD POP CUR 
 
After sixteen years, The Cure is back with their fourteenth studio album. Songs from the record were previewed during their 90-date, 33-country 'Shows Of A Lost World' tour for more than 1.3 million people to overwhelming fan and critical acclaim. Speaking about, "Alone," the opening track on the album, Robert Smith says, "It's the track that unlocked the record; as soon as we had that piece of music recorded, I knew it was the opening song and I felt the whole album come into focus -- that was the moment when I knew the song -- and the album -- were real."
Temporary
Everything Is Recorded 
CD POP EVE 
 
Everything Is Recorded albums are feasts of collaboration, and this soul-enriching new album is no exception. The guest list overflows with talent: Florence Welch, Sampha, Bill Callahan, Jah Wobble, Kamasi Washington, Nourished by Time, Alabaster DePlume, Noah Cyrus. The silvery thread linking all these voices together is, of course, Richard Russell himself, by design the least visible member of Everything Is Recorded. Russell began recording his collaborators' musings on death and loss early on in the process for this album, and although they only survive in two audio collages ("October," "The Summons"), their power suffuses the record. These are the most luminous and relaxed compositions of his career. His music dissolves the borders between sampled and recorded, between modernity and antiquity, life and death, now and forever. He grasps the true meaning of his album's title: We may be, in fact, temporary. But our longing for each other, for peace, for love and communion, goes on forever.

From Zero
Linkin Park 
CD POP LIN 
 
Linkin Park is one of the most innovative and well known rock bands today. Having debuted their first album, Hybrid Theory, in 2000, their success has only grown from there. Linkin Park has sold more than 70 million records worldwide and has won two Grammy Awards. What makes Linkin Park such an influential band for our time is that they explore multiple genres from album to album. Having kicked off their career with Hybrid Theory being on the heavy rock side, they then went on to practice layering with electronic music, then continued on creating a new album going back to their heavy rock, and ultimately experimented with a more pop oriented record, which being One More Light

Balloonerism
Mac Miller 
CD POP MIL 
 
Balloonerism is the seventh studio album by American rapper Mac Miller. It is his second posthumous album since his death in September 2018. Miller recorded the album in 2014, around the time his mixtape Faces was released.

End Will Show Us How
Tremonti
CD POP TRE 
 
The End Will Show Us How is the sixth studio album by American heavy metal band Tremonti. It was released on January 10, 2025 through Napalm Records. The record was produced by Michael "Elvis" Baskette, who Mark Tremonti had worked with since 2007.

A Complete Unknown
Original Movie Picture Soundtrack 
CD SHO COM 
 
A Complete Unknown is the soundtrack album to the Bob Dylan biopic of the same name. The album consists primarily of songs written by Dylan himself and performed by Timothée Chalamet, who portrays Dylan in the film.
